Did you know that cauliflower comes in purple? 🟣

Aside from being striking in colour, purple cauliflower is considered more nutritious than its white counterpart. Anthocyanins cause the purple hue and are also a potent antioxidant offering many health benefits, including anti-inflammatory, anti-cancer and cardiovascular protection.

The ingredients in our Seasonal Vegetable Chop vary between batches to ensure your bird eats a diverse range of nutrients and never get bored of their vegetables. Our latest batch includes purple cauliflower!

This is George (). George is a sulphur-crested cockatoo who was fed only sunflower seeds for nearly 40 years. Sadly, due to his owner becoming unwell, George spent the last few years in a very small cage with little enrichment or exercise.
This poor diet and lack of movement caused him to become obese, and he weighed 2 kg when he was surrendered.

With time, patience, and lots of care, George is now eating pellets, a lower-fat seed mix, and vegetables. After just two months in care, he now weighs 1.5 kg.
Amazing work by . This is a great reminder that all birds can learn to eat healthier foods, no matter how long they’ve been on a seed diet—it just takes persistence and patience. šŸ¦œšŸ’š

A common reason why avian vets will see a bird for the first time is the owner has noticed a lack of feathers on their bird’s body.

Feather loss can be mild or more noticeable and range from causes such as normal moulting to more serious reasons such as viral infections, skin pathology and plucking.

We encourage fear-free handling whereever possible. Laura one of our customers gives our Carrot Cake bird bread as a treat after giving her conure his daily medication. Medicating a bird for an ongoing medical condition can be stressful for both the owner and the bird. By rewarding your bird after it takes its medication, it can encourage voluntary intake and even make birds look forward to taking their medication. The goal is to find a treat that is high demand!
